MechWarrior Online Minimum System Spec:

CPU:
Core 2 Duo E6750 2.66GHz
Athlon II X2 245e

GPU:
GeForce 8800GT
Radeon HD 5600/5700

RAM: 4 GB

OS: Windows Vista 32-bit

DirectX: DX9

HDD Space: 4 GB

MechWarrior Online Recommended System Spec:

CPU: Core i3-2500 AMD Athlon II X4 650

GPU: GeForce GTX 285 Radeon HD 5830

RAM: 8 GB OS: Windows 7 SP-1 64-Bit

DirectX: DX9

HDD Space: 4 GB

Source: mwomercs.com official-developer-update

Yeah the fact that paying $120 for the "Legendary" founder's package only gets you 3 months of "Premium Account" scares me as to what the prices will be like for premium account...

I know there are many of us longtime FASA Mechwarrior universe fans out here and probably lots of gamers that have great memories from the other MW games so they probably have a pretty good potential customer base, but if they are expecting to cash in on WOW type monthly service fees right off the bat, there are a ton of other MMOs that have tried and failed going down that road.

Glad there is a F2P option so I can test drive it and see, I have big hopes for this and just hope it turns out to be terrific and my worries misplaced.
